ProCal II Calibration Flash Tool Instructions:

Read the instructions below in their entirety prior to beginning the flash procedure. If you have questions or concerns after reading these instructions, call the Ford Racing Techline at 1-800-367-3788.

CAUTION! NEVER OPERATE THE ENGINE UNTIL PROGRAMMING OF YOUR PERFORMANCE CALIBRATION

HAS COMPLETED SUCCESSFULLY. OPERATION WHILE USING THE WRONG CALIBRATION MAY

RESULT IN PERMANENT ENGINE DAMAGE AND WILL VOID ANY WARRANTY (IF APPLICABLE).

FORD RACING CALIBRATIONS ARE DESIGNED FOR 91 OR HIGHER OCTANE FUEL. IF YOU HAVE

LOWER THAN 91 OCTANE FUEL IN THE TANK, TRY TO WAIT UNTIL YOU ARE ABLE TO PUT 91 OR

HIGHER OCTANE FUEL IN THE TANK PRIOR TO PROGRAMMING. FORD RACING RECOMMENDS

THE USE OF 93 OCTANE FUEL IF AVAILABLE IN YOUR AREA

This ProCal II tool has been designed to deliver a performance calibration to your vehicle and will preserve a copy of your vehicle’s stock calibration, should you decide to remove the performance pack for any reason. The tool will be locked to your vehicle until the original stock calibration has been restored. Once the original calibration has been restored to your vehicle, the performance calibration and corresponding hardware can be installed on another vehicle of the same year, make, model and PCM part number.

Prepare ProCal II:

STEP 1: Peel back the rubber boot from the lower portion of the ProCal II to expose the memory card socket.

STEP 2: Insert the DB25 connector of the J1962 cable into the top of the ProCal II. Finger-tighten the retaining screws of the DB25 so that it is firmly fastened to the ProCal II.

Prepare Vehicle:

STEP 3:

Remove the memory card from its plastic case and insert into the socket of the ProCal II with the card label facing the same direction as the ProCal II display screen. Return the rubber boot to its original position to cover the memory card socket.

Make sure your vehicle’s battery is fully charged (at least 12.0 volts) and all accessories (radio, interior fan, headlights, etc.) are off. If you are unsure if your vehicle’s battery is fully charged, connect a battery charger prior to beginning the programming process.

CAUTION: If your ProCal II aborts programming due to low voltage or if the programming process is interrupted for any reason, you may need to send your PCM back to Ford Racing for repair before the vehicle will start.

STEP 4: Locate the onboard Diagnostic Link Connector (DLC) beneath the driver side dashboard. The exact location of the DLC will vary with vehicle model and year but will always be on the driver’s side. For 2005 and newer Mustangs, it is located under the dashboard directly above the driver’s left knee.

STEP 5: Hold down the ENTER button on the Procal II while inserting the OBDII connector into the vehicle DLC, then let go of the ENTER button. The tool will update itself with the software from the memory card. Do not continue to the next step until the red error light goes out and a menu appears that says

“Programming / Diagnostics / Setup”. Note that holding down the ENTER button is only necessary the very first time you use a particular memory card. For every subsequent use of the same card, you do not need to hold down the ENTER button while inserting the Procal II connector into the DLC.

STEP 20A: Write down the values displayed for tire and axle for future reference in the event it is ever desired to return the vehicle to the stock calibration. If the vehicle has stock tires on the drive wheels and a stock axle ratio, skip to step 25A.

Use the Up/Down arrow keys to change tire revolutions per mile and press ENTER when desired revolutions per mile is obtained.

Note: Calculate revolutions per mile by dividing 63360 inches/mile (5280 feet/mile x 12 inches/foot) by the measured circumference of your tire (in inches).

STEP 25A:

For example, if the measured circumference of a tire on one of the vehicle's driven wheels is 84 inches, revolutions per mile for your tire size would be 754.

Another way to calculate this number is by utilizing the sizing information written on the side of the tire.

For a tire of the size P285/35-19, calculate tire revolutions per mile as follows:

Revs per mile = 20850 / { [ (2 * 285 * 35) / 2540] + 19 } = 776.4 which rounds down to 776.

After programming, if the speedometer indicates a different vehicle speed than a GPS unit, the programmed tire revolutions per mile can be tweaked to increase speedometer accuracy. For example,

If the calculated tire size is 776 revolutions per mile and a GPS unit says the vehicle is traveling 70 mph while the speedometer says 75 mph, simply multiply the calculated tire size by 75 / 70 to give 776 *

(75 / 70) = 831 revolutions per mile.

STEP 24B: Write down the values displayed for tire and axle for future reference in the event it is ever desired to return the vehicle to the stock calibration.

Use the Up/Down arrow keys to change tire revolutions per mile and press ENTER when desired revolutions per mile is obtained.

Note: Calculate revolutions per mile by dividing 63360 inches/mile (5280 feet/mile x 12 inches/foot) by the measured circumference of your tire (in inches).

For example, if the measured circumference of a tire on one of the vehicle's driven wheels is 84 inches, revolutions per mile for your tire size would be 754.

Another way to calculate this number is by utilizing the sizing information written on the side of the tire.

For a tire of the size P285/35-19, calculate tire revolutions per mile as follows:

Revs per mile = 20850 / { [ (2 * 285 * 35) / 2540] + 19 } = 776.4 which rounds down to 776.

After programming, if the speedometer indicates a different vehicle speed than a GPS unit, the programmed tire revolutions per mile can be tweaked to increase speedometer accuracy. For example,

If the calculated tire size is 776 revolutions per mile and a GPS unit says the vehicle is traveling 70 mph while the speedometer says 75 mph, simply multiply the calculated tire size by 75 / 70 to give 776 * (75 /

70) = 831 revolutions per mile.

Important Note (All kits except M-6066-MSVT29D / PD and M-6066-MGT624D / PD):

Set this parameter to N initially. If you experience audible spark knock after programming your PCM with this setting, go back to step 21B and change this parameter to Y as soon as possible. If audible spark knock continues after setting this parameter to Y, call the techline for assistance.

Important Note (Kits M-6066-MSVT29D / PD and M-6066-MGT624D / PD only):

Set this parameter to Y if you are using 91 octane fuel. Set this parameter to N initially if you are using 93 or higher octane fuel. If you experience audible spark knock after programming your PCM with this setting, go back to step 21B and change this parameter to Y as soon as possible. If audible spark knock continues after setting this parameter to Y, call the techline for assistance

Notes (All vehicle model years):

Vehicles equipped with Tire Pressure Monitoring may illuminate the TPMS warning lamp after PCM reprogramming.

Provided the lamp was not illuminated prior to beginning the programming process, it will turn off after 10 miles or so of normal driving.
